AIESEC Malaysia is partnering with one of South-East Asia's largest NGOs: SOLS 24/7. We are offering exchange participants the opportunity to develop their own educational program with the support of SOLS 24/7, and then implement it during a 7 week placement at one of their community centers. Exchange participants get to work in one of 40 local communities across Malaysia, teaching basic IT and any tech related subjects they are interested in (e.g. photography, music production, videography). Each community is different, ranging from urban, to rural, to jungle, to islands and to small town or township. Teaching to Malay people, Indians, Chinese and even native indigenous tribes people. The age groups of students also varies from center to center, ranging from young children to middle aged housewives.

JOB DESCRIPTION

Training, motivating and inspiring underprivileged youths through our basic IT program.

Planning activities and challenges to test the practical IT skills of the students.

Running tech-related workshops, classes and activities. (e.g. photography, music, production,

videography, graphic design)

Implement teaching programs within the community

Providing IT support to the community centre and its usersAssisting the Community Development Officer with any troubleshooting or IT related tasks which

affect the community centre.

Ensuring that all the computers in the community centre are functioning and being

used properly by the students. Supporting local NGOs and individuals in registering online for

funding, setting up email and social media accounts etc.

Undertaking community development works with SOLS 24/7

Assisting the Community Development Officer in conducting English classes.

Being actively involved in SOLS 24/7 events, workshops and activities.

Page 5: Malaysia it community champion ukm

INTERNSHIP DETAILS

• Duration : 8 weeks

• Realization Date: Flexible

• Free accommodation: Exchange participants will be staying in the community centre.

• Free food only available while staying at Segambut Youth Development Centre for the first week. No food provided in the following 7 weeks.

• Transportation is covered with allowance only for project purpose.

• EPs will spend the first week having induction about Malaysia, SOLS and

project in SOLS Tech. Besides, EPs are more like designing teaching plan &

framework and present to SOLS in the first week and then move to the related

centre to teach the children for the rest of 7 weeks

• No hot water in the bathroom, shared bathroom.

• Pickup service from train/bus station is provided(Guidance provided)

The National University of Malaysia,

abbreviated UKM is a public university

located in Bangi,Selangor which is about

35 km south of Kuala Lumpur.Universiti

Kebangsaan Malaysia is one of five

research universities in the country. It was

ranked number 259th in the world by QS

World University Rankings in 2014. AIESEC in

UKM was officially set up in 1978 and

quickly proved itself to be one of the

leading student organizations in the

varsity. LC UKM is the second oldest LC in

the history of AIESEC Malaysia.
